Namaqua National Park

0
(0)
Namaqua National Park is one of South Africa’s most remarkable natural areas, famous for its spectacular spring wildflower displays. During the flowering season, the normally dry landscape transforms into a colorful carpet of blooms stretching across hills and plains. The park offers visitors a chance to experience a unique desert ecosystem, scenic drives, and quiet walking areas. It is an ideal destination for nature lovers, photographers, and travelers seeking wide open landscapes.

Opening Hours & Entry

Open:

• Open Daily: 07:00 – 19:00 (seasonal variations may apply)

Entry Fee:

• Entry Fee: Conservation fee applies

Best Time to Visit:

• Best Time to Visit: August to September during peak wildflower season

Location

📌Namaqua National Park, Northern Cape, South Africa
